What happens if I stay longer than my scheduled shift?

We understand that there are instances where your patient requires more care and you have to stay past your scheduled shift.

In this case, when the original end time for your shift comes up, you will be instructed to either clock out or select 'I've been authorized to extend my shift, keep me clocked in.'

Following your selection, a pop up will appear, confirming that your shift has been extended. When you have completed your shift, please clock out as normal.

What if working past my scheduled shift results in working over 40 hours a week? Is there overtime?

It's also possible for you to earn overtime on an extended shift if it is approved by the facility coordinator or supervisor. You MUST be approved to work overtime.

Any hours worked after 40 hours will be calculated at an overtime rate.
